首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Jenkins环境变量条件集

是用于在Jenkins构建过程中根据环境变量的值来执行不同的操作的一种配置方式。它允许开发人员根据构建环境中的不同条件来动态地执行不同的构建步骤或配置。

分类: Jenkins环境变量条件集可以根据条件的类型进行分类。常见的分类包括:

  1. 字符串匹配:根据环境变量的字符串值进行匹配,例如匹配特定的分支或标签名称。
  2. 数值比较:根据环境变量的数值进行比较,例如判断构建号是否大于某个特定值。
  3. 正则表达式匹配:使用正则表达式对环境变量的值进行匹配。
  4. 配置文件匹配:根据配置文件的内容匹配环境变量,例如匹配特定的配置文件内容。

优势: 使用Jenkins环境变量条件集的优势包括:

  1. 灵活性:可以根据不同的环境变量值来执行不同的操作,使得构建过程更加灵活和可配置。
  2. 自动化:可以根据环境变量的值自动触发特定的构建步骤或配置,减少人工干预,提高自动化水平。
  3. 多样性:支持多种条件匹配方式,适用于各种不同的构建场景。

应用场景: Jenkins环境变量条件集可以应用于多种场景,例如:

  1. 分支管理:可以根据不同的分支名称执行不同的构建步骤,例如主分支和开发分支可以有不同的构建配置。
  2. 版本控制:可以根据不同的版本号执行不同的构建操作,例如只有在发布版本时才执行特定的测试或部署步骤。
  3. 多环境支持:可以根据不同的环境变量值构建不同的部署包,例如根据环境变量指定的目标环境选择不同的配置文件。

腾讯云相关产品: 腾讯云提供了多个与Jenkins环境变量条件集相关的产品,例如:

  1. 腾讯云容器服务:用于在容器环境中运行Jenkins,并且可以根据环境变量的值动态调整容器的配置和资源。
  2. 腾讯云函数计算:用于基于事件驱动的无服务器计算,可以根据触发事件的环境变量值执行特定的函数。
  3. 腾讯云弹性伸缩:用于自动伸缩云资源,可以根据环境变量的值调整伸缩策略和目标资源配置。

产品介绍链接地址:

  1. 腾讯云容器服务:https://cloud.tencent.com/product/ccs
  2. 腾讯云函数计算:https://cloud.tencent.com/product/scf
  3. 腾讯云弹性伸缩:https://cloud.tencent.com/product/as
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

22分59秒

第十九章:字节码指令集与解析举例/56-条件跳转指令

8分15秒

第十九章:字节码指令集与解析举例/57-比较条件跳转指令

15分32秒

第十九章:字节码指令集与解析举例/59-无条件跳转指令

14分10秒

第十九章:字节码指令集与解析举例/58-多条件分支跳转指令

2分13秒

11_尚硅谷_MySQL基础_配置环境变量

7分8秒

28_尚硅谷_MySQL基础_条件查询介绍

1分40秒

36_尚硅谷_MySQL基础_【案例讲解】条件查询

3分58秒

29_尚硅谷_MySQL基础_条件运算符的使用

18分49秒

33.尚硅谷_JS基础_条件分支语句

11分46秒

25.尚硅谷_JS基础_条件运算符

领券